Output e86fe1cfa0b2771537f840a2d1a037d15dd60a542eda5e31733dc32f884e3809:0

value
1749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82eb7609d26ea3df495a617aaa4ee719dd40044f OP_EQUAL
address
3DdFqc33HQsw3D2nudRfHA4U4T8fn9azae
transaction
e86fe1cfa0b2771537f840a2d1a037d15dd60a542eda5e31733dc32f884e3809
spent
true